visual studio code 配置npm run serve
时间: 2024-12-31 13:11:49 浏览: 143
### 配置 VSCode 使用 `npm run serve` 启动项目
当遇到在 Visual Studio Code (VSCode) 中执行 `npm run serve` 报错的情况时,通常是因为路径错误或其他配置问题引起的。对于提到的 ENOENT 错误,表明系统找不到指定的文件或目录[^1]。
#### 解决方案概述
为了确保能够顺利通过 VSCode 执行 `npm run serve` ,可以按照以下建议操作:
- **确认工作区设置**:保证当前的工作空间根目录包含了项目的 package.json 文件。如果不在同一级别,则需调整工作区至包含此文件的位置。
- **清理并重新安装依赖项**:移除现有的 node_modules 文件夹以及 package-lock.json 或 yarn.lock 文件(如果有),之后再次运行 `npm install` 来重建这些资源[^2]。
```bash
rm -rf node_modules package-lock.json
npm cache clean --force
npm install
```
- **验证命令行工具功能正常**:既然 cmd 下能正常使用该命令而 VSCode 不可,可能意味着终端环境变量配置不同步。尝试重启计算机使全局 PATH 更新生效;另外也可以考虑更新 Node.js 版本来解决潜在兼容性问题。
- **检查 VSCode 终端配置**:有时 IDE 自带的集成终端可能会因为某些原因导致行为异常。可以在 VSCode 的用户/工作区设置里查找关于 "terminal.integrated.shell.windows" 的选项,并确保其指向正确的 shell 可执行程序位置。
- **启用调试模式查看更多信息**:利用 `--verbose` 参数增加日志输出量以便更好地理解具体失败点所在。
```bash
npm run serve --verbose
```
上述措施有助于排查和修复由于开发环境中特定因素造成的 `npm run serve` 失败现象[^4]。
---
阅读全文
相关推荐


















